Failed findings
-
sick-employee policy not followedcriticalOfficial wording: Potentially Hazardous Food Meets Temperature Requirement During Storage, Preparation Display And ServiceInspector note: IMPROPER TEMPERATURE OF COOKED TONGUE 60.8F, BEEF 113.5F, PORK 118.9F STORED ON STEAM TABLE, CARNITAS 109.5-113.6F DISPLAYED FOR SALE AND STORED UNDER HEAT LAMP. INSTRUCTED MANAGER TO DISCARD APPROXIMATELY 50LBS AND $200 OF PRODUCT. ALL HOT FOOD MUST MAINTAIN 140F OR ABOVE DURING STORAGE, DISPLAY AND SERVICE. COOKED AND COOLED FOOD MUST BE REHEATED TO 165F. CRITICAL VIOLATION 7-38-005A CITATION ISSUED.
